WebNot all chemistry tests are useful or reliable in animal species. The test pads for urine specific gravity, urobilinogen, nitrite, and leukocytes are not used for veterinary patients. Urine pH. The normal urine pH range for dogs and cats is 6 to 7.5. The clinical presentation of AIP is highly variable and non-specific. The patients are typically asymptomatic, with most gene carriers having no family history because the condition had remained latent for several generations. The syndrome marked by acute attacks affects only 10% of gene carriers. The mean age at diagnosis is 33 years old. Like other porphyrias, AIP is more likely to present in women. Sometimes, your dog’s urine may have red blood (hematuria) in it or assume a pinkish tint. The red/pink color in the urine means that your dog may be suffering from urinary tract infection, inflammation of the bladder, kidney problems, crystals in the urine, or bladder stones. how does nose bleeding occurWebThere are three main ways to collect urine in cats and dogs.
